Bachelor of Science in Computer Science-> Digital Forensics

This program in Digital Forensic Science (formerly called Computer Forensics) is the science and practice of preserving, acquiring, and analyzing digital evidence to support formal legal actions.
Digital Forensic is one of the growing professional fields within law enforcement agencies. Growing uses of computer and internet have detected several sophisticated crimes and frauds. These crimes have necessitated the introduction program in the field of Digital Forensic.

Digital Forensics is a combination of Cyber Law disciplne and Passive Security techniques applied for Event Invetsigation & Evidence Retrival.

Career opportunities for B.Sc. (Computer Science – Digital Forensic ) are:

- Intelligence Officer at the Embassies and Consulates
- Cyber Intelligence Officer
- Wireless Network Administrator
- Mobile Systems Developer
- Computer Crime & Investigation Officer
- Intrusion Forensic Engineer
